Gamma-Ray Burst Afterglows
Extended, fading emissions in multi-wavelength are observed following Gamma-ray bursts (GRBs). Recent broadband observational campaigns led by the Swift Observatory reveal rich features of these GRB afterglows. I consider various possibilities for making gamma-ray bursts, particularly from close binaries. In addition to the much-studied neutron star+neutron star and black hole+neutron star cases usually considered good candidates for short-duration bursts, there are also other possibilities. متن کاملHigh-Precision Photometry of the Gamma-Ray Burst 020813: The Smoothest Afterglow Yet
We report results of our precise reduction of the high signal-to-noise V RI observations of the optical afterglow of the gamma-ray burst GRB020813 obtained by Gladders & Hall with the Magellan 6.5-m telescope 3.9 − 4.9 hours after the burst. متن کاملGamma-ray Burst Energetics
We estimate the fraction of the total energy in a Gamma-Ray Burst (GRB) that is radiated in photons during the main burst. Random internal collisions among different shells limit the efficiency for converting bulk kinetic energy to photons.
